In Sweden, hospital staff working with patients infected by Covid-19 are wearing aprons as part of their essential PPE. They need to exchange their aprons in between every patient interaction to prevent spreading the disease. One staff member can go through as many as 50 of these aprons per day.
As part of #sharethelove, 15 colleagues from Ambius and Rentokil in Sweden have taken part in a factory shift producing these vital aprons by cutting out the various pieces from rolls of plastic film and eventually welding the pieces together to form the apron.
As you can see from the pictures, the RI team, included our MD, sales and service directors, wore the same aprons while conducting the work to ensure safety at all times.
